Transaction 5638c5155c533febaff49f23a310513368c63cc68c9ce082aba1bd667e4a7718
1 Input
1 Output
-
5638c5155c533febaff49f23a310513368c63cc68c9ce082aba1bd667e4a7718:0
- value
- 6642117
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f53cf93082c6f70d758324c2281f046e088cc824 OP_EQUAL
- address
- 3Q3iX3jwXxKcBC4UrhB4jdSVZny14ad6v7